Description
Kanna Kirishima is a central member of the Imperial Combat Revue's Flower Division, originating from Okinawa, Japan, with a birth date of September 7, 1903. She stands out as the tallest and physically strongest member of the team, a distinction earned through her rigorous training as the 28th successor of the Kirishima school of Ryukyu karate. Her formidable physique and martial prowess make her the division's primary melee combatant, capable of feats of strength far beyond those of her peers, such as supporting heavy stage equipment with one hand.

Personality-wise, Kanna is characterized by a straightforward, big-hearted, and easygoing nature. Her demeanor is often described as tomboyish, which leads her to be frequently cast in male roles during the division's theatrical performances, such as the character Son Wukong from Journey to the West. Despite her tough and confident exterior, she possesses a hidden, shy side that emerges in romantic or overly sentimental situations. Another defining trait is her immense appetite; she is known to consume large quantities of food, including ten bowls of rice for breakfast, to fuel her powerful physique, and she has a keen knowledge of restaurants offering hearty meals at good prices. However, her culinary skills are noted to be limited in range.

Kanna's primary motivation stems from a deep-seated sense of duty and loyalty to the Flower Division and her comrades. She is protective of her teammates and harbors a particular fondness for children. In the story, she serves as a foundational member of the Flower Division, originally brought in by the vice-commander, and acts as a pillar of strength and resilience for the group. Notably, in moments of crisis when other members show doubt or fear, Kanna's mental fortitude remains steadfast, making her a reliable source of encouragement and power in battle. She is also trusted with piloting the airship Shogeimaru, a skill she learned before the death of the previous commander.

Her most significant relationship is her spirited rivalry with fellow team member Sumire Kanzaki. The two constantly bicker, with Kanna calling Sumire a "cactus girl" in response to being labeled a "gorilla girl". This rivalry, however, belies a deep mutual care and respect; Kanna is deeply saddened by Sumire's eventual retirement, even unable to watch the final performance. Their bond is further solidified when they discover a shared vulnerability, specifically deep-seated phobias—Kanna has a severe fear of snakes, stemming from a traumatic childhood incident where she was bitten while training alone. She also shares a strong, close friendship with Maria Tachibana, having joined the division around the same time.

Kanna undergoes a notable period of development following the mysterious death of her father at the hands of a rival. Overwhelmed by a desire for revenge, she temporarily leaves the Flower Division before ultimately choosing to return, deciding to honor his legacy by continuing her duty rather than succumbing to vengeance. On the battlefield, her abilities are formidable. Piloting a red Koubu unit configured for close-quarters combat, she is a devastating close-range attacker whose martial arts skills translate directly into immense destructive power, culminating in her special attack, the Super Rinpai, which can decimate multiple enemies at once. Her strength is such that she is considered capable of fighting demons even without her Koubu.
